Dive into Pop-under Ads: A Beginner's Guide

Pop-under ads are a type of online advertising that appear in a new tab beneath the current web page when a user clicks on a link. These ads typically remain hidden until the user closes the primary page, at which point they spring up. They are often viewed negatively for being intrusive and disruptive, but they can also be an effective way to engage users who are already engaged with a particular topic or category.

Pop-Under Ads: How They Work and Why They're Used

Pop-under ads present themselves as an internet marketing technique. These ads appear behind the main browser window when a user visits a particular website. Unlike pop-up ads, which immediately become visible, pop-under ads load passively in the background.
